Output 6116fa032250b6f628ef566e9200c57e6158268255ef21c93b7c49b89a0859a0:1

value
77881304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c5ef5e8728818e646e32dc6b3241b5913bcee38 OP_EQUAL
address
35jdQxgpeB7pRwWdwgAcTn2uvpuXaypk1y
transaction
6116fa032250b6f628ef566e9200c57e6158268255ef21c93b7c49b89a0859a0
spent
true